Working Principles

The AMS22B5A1BLASL315N utilizes Hall effect technology to detect the magnetic field generated by a rotating magnet. This information is then converted into an electrical signal that represents the angular position of the magnet and, by extension, the rotating object to which it is attached.

Detailed Application Field Plans

This sensor is commonly used in industrial automation, robotics, automotive systems, and aerospace applications. It is particularly well-suited for applications requiring precise control of rotational position, such as servo motor feedback systems and steering angle measurement in vehicles.
